40 Weeks: The Ultimate Biological Masterpiece. 🧬 ​It’s a question I’m constantly exploring in my research here in Encinitas: How does a single cell transform into a breathing, crying, perfect human in just 280 days? ​Fetal development isn't just "growth"—it’s a highly coordinated, evidence-based sequence of events where timing is everything. From the first spark of conception to the final lung maturation, your body is performing the most complex task in nature. ​The Deep Research Milestones: ​The Critical First Trimester (Weeks 1-12): This is the high-sensitivity phase. By week 7, the heart is already beating. By week 11, the embryo officially becomes a fetus, with fingers, toes, and facial features defined. This is when the "blueprint" for every major organ system is laid down. ​The Rapid Second Trimester (Weeks 13-27): This is where the magic becomes felt. Around week 20, most moms feel those first kicks (quickening). The fetus can now swallow, hear your voice, and even develop a sleep-wake cycle. ​The Finishing Third Trimester (Weeks 28-40): This phase is all about weight gain and "brain-building." The lungs begin producing surfactant (essential for breathing), and the brain creates trillions of new neural connections every single day. ​Term Maturity: By week 37, the fetus is considered early-term. Those final weeks are crucial for fat storage and temperature regulation, preparing your baby for life outside the womb. ​Understanding these stages helps us appreciate just how much "work" your body is doing behind the scenes. Safe Core Modifications for Pregnancy (Weeks 13–40 🤰) Comment SAFE & I’ll send you a free prenatal fitness guide to break everything down for you trimester by trimester for what is safe in pregnancy 🩷 Pregnant and wondering “can I even work my core anymore?” YES. You just need smarter modifications — not endless crunches or holding your breath. From the second trimester through week 40, your core work should focus on pressure management, deep core engagement, and functional strength — aka the stuff that supports your bump, protects your pelvic floor, and actually helps with birth + recovery. These modifications help: ✔️ Minimize coning & doming ✔️ Support your pelvic floor ✔️ Build strength without strain ✔️ Prep your body for labor AND postpartum recovery If your core feels shaky, tight, or totally different each trimester — you’re not broken.
